In the morning, start your adventure in Panjim, the capital city of Goa. Visit the historic Fontainhas neighborhood, known for its Portuguese architecture and colorful buildings. Take a leisurely walk along the picturesque streets, stopping by the iconic Our Lady of Immaculate Conception Church. In the afternoon, head to Dona Paula and indulge in thrilling water sports like jet skiing and parasailing. As the evening sets in, enjoy a sunset cruise along the Mandovi River, savoring breathtaking views of the coastline.
Embark on an adrenaline-pumping trek to Dudhsagar Falls, one of the highest waterfalls in India. Start early in the morning and drive to the base of the falls. Enjoy a scenic hike through the lush Western Ghats, crossing streams and bridges along the way. Upon reaching the majestic falls, take a refreshing dip in the natural pool. Spend the afternoon picnicking by the waterfall before heading back to your accommodation.
Gear up for an exciting day of scuba diving at Grand Island. Depart early in the morning for the boat ride to the island. Dive into the crystal-clear waters of the Arabian Sea, exploring vibrant coral reefs and encountering colorful marine life. Certified divers can opt for deeper dives, while beginners can enjoy introductory dives with trained instructors. After a day of diving, relax on the pristine beaches of Grand Island and soak up the sun before heading back to Goa.

For off the beaten path adventures, consider exploring the Bhagwan Mahaveer Wildlife Sanctuary in Mollem village. Trek through dense forests, spot exotic wildlife, and visit the famous Tambdi Surla Temple, an ancient 12th-century Shiva temple surrounded by lush greenery. Another local favorite is the Netravali Wildlife Sanctuary, where you can embark on wildlife safaris, jungle treks, and enjoy serene waterfall hikes. These lesser-known gems offer unique opportunities to connect with nature and witness the biodiversity of Goa.
